> [fsspec|https://filesystem-spec.readthedocs.io/en/latest] defines a common 
> API for a variety filesystem implementations. I'm proposing a FSSpecWrapper, 
> similar to S3FSWrapper, that works with any fsspec implementation.
>  
> Right now, pyarrow has a pyarrow.filesystems.S3FSWrapper, which is specific 
> to s3fs. 
> [https://github.com/apache/arrow/blob/21ad7ac1162eab188a1e15923fb1de5b795337ec/python/pyarrow/filesystem.py#L320].
>  This implementation could be removed entirely once an FSSPecWrapper is done, 
> or kept as an alias if it's part of the public API.
>  
> This is realted to ARROW-3717, which requested a GCSFSWrapper for working 
> with google cloud storage.
